Whole genome sequence of the rifamycin B-producing strain Amycolatopsis mediterranei S699

J Bacteriol. 2011 Oct;193(19):5562-3. doi: 10.1128/JB.05819-11.

Abstract

Amycolatopsis mediterranei S699 is an actinomycete that produces an important antibiotic, rifamycin B. Semisynthetic derivatives of rifamycin B are used for the treatment of tuberculosis, leprosy, and AIDS-related mycobacterial infections. Here, we report the complete genome sequence (10.2 Mb) of A. mediterranei S699, with 9,575 predicted coding sequences.
